Lady Blazers Make Quick Work of Dawson Springs in Season Opener

The University Heights Academy softball team hit the field for the first time this season on Monday, getting off to a winning start with a 20-5 victory over visiting Dawson Springs.

The Lady Blazers won their opener for the first time since 2019 while sending the Lady Panthers to a fifth-straight defeat to start the season.

Katherine Wood got the start in the circle for UHA, and she sat down the Lady Panthers in order in the first inning.  The Lady Blazers took the lead on a wild pitch in their first at-bat and doubled the advantage on Gracie Ausenbaugh’s RBI single.  UHA tacked on a third run on a passed ball ahead of a triple by Emily Dilday.

Dawson Springs turned four walks and a pair of hit-by-pitches into four runs in the second, with Chayse Gilliland coming on in relief of Wood to get the final two outs of the inning.

UHA blew the game open with nine runs in its second at-bat, highlighted by an RBI single for Dilday and a two-run single by Wood.

The Lady Panthers got a run back on a wild pitch in the third before the Lady Blazers finished things off with eight more runs in the bottom of the frame.  Gilliland’s RBI single was the only hit of the inning, with UHA taking advantage of four walks and five batters hit by pitches.

Gilliland got the win in the circle, allowing a single earned run with no hits, five walks, and a pair of strikeouts.  Wood gave up four earned runs with three walks and three strikeouts.

Wood and Gilliland each finished with two RBI, and Dilday finished 2/2 at the plate with two runs driven in.

Tallie Robinson took the loss for the Lady Panthers, surrendering 20 earned runs on five hits with 12 walks and a strikeout.

UHA will hit the road on Tuesday to face Northwest, TN, while Dawson Springs will travel to McLean County for a doubleheader.
